Modern Pendant Lighting - How To Pick One for Your Home

Lighting is what sets the tone of a room — the right glare can draw guests in and make them comfortable.


It adds that needed function and style, transforming a space and tying the room together. And when it comes to getting the right aesthetics and utility out of your lights, modern pendant lighting is where it’s at.


Whether you’re hoping to make a statement above your dining room table or you want to add some mood lighting to your living room space, pendant lights are a fantastic option. They come in a variety of designs to fit all space styles.


That being said, with so many pendant lights available for purchase, you may feel overwhelmed by what to choose. How do you pick a unit that perfectly accents your room while upholding the function of what a light is supposed to provide?


Consider the Purpose


Before buying, always ask yourself what you want the pendant light to do or what role you want it to play in your home. Are you hoping to add focused light over your island countertop? Reduce shadows for ambient light in your kitchen space? Or are you hoping to build a dramatic entryway with the unit acting as the focal point?


When it comes to workspaces, opt for pendant units that boast a downward glow. They will provide all the task lighting needed over your kitchen countertop or island. If you’re working with a kitchen or entryway where no shadows are allowed, investing in an open-bottom or opaque-finished pendant light would do you well.


Dining spaces don’t need this shadow for mealtime, which is why we suggest an option with a warmer light. Translation: Your luminaire should offer that softened, approachable light, adding to the charming, cozy atmosphere of the area. Your living room will always benefit from a statement piece with a focal point that showcases your personality.


Size and Scale Matter


Probably the most common mistake of people purchasing new lighting is buying a unit that’s either too big or too small. When choosing a diameter for your modern pendant, simply consider proportion: space size.


Placing a much larger pendant over that too-small table is too bold, and both elements will clash — just as a small pendant over your larger dining table will likely get lost and underwhelm your guests. The dimensions of your space and ceiling are major factors in the list of considerations.


Height and Placement


Where you install your pendant light determines how well it will work in your space. Over a table or countertop, the bottom of the pendant should be about 30-36 inches from the surface to provide adequate lighting and not interfere with the line of sight.


In an open space, you’ll want to go high enough to avoid hitting your head but not so high that it doesn’t add any aesthetic appeal or address the space in terms of scale and style. If you’re installing multiple pendants over a countertop or island, it’s important to have proper spacing to avoid crowding and to deliver consistent light.


Doing so gives you space for light and also feels visually balanced. You’ll also want to consider how high your ceilings are, taller spaces may require longer suspension cables to have it look just right, whereas you can use a flush mount or semi-flush pendant in a lower ceiling to achieve a streamlined look without any visual clutter.


Materials and Finishes


Modern pendant lights can be found in a range of different materials, from sleek metals to textured glass and woven natural fibers. When selecting your lighting, think about the overall look and feel of your home. For an industrial style, you’ll want something in black or brushed metal. Are you drawn to a coastal or organic scheme? Rattan or Linen creates a warm texture.

Choosing the Right Light Bulb


Don’t let your lighting be ruined by a disappointing bulb. LED is a great choice because of its long-lasting and energy-efficient aspects, but it also provides a more environmentally conscious lighting solution. Are you all about mood lighting? Don’t forget to use a dimmer switch, it sets the perfect tone for making a space extraordinarily inviting!
